Masayoshi Uchida is a scholar working on Neurology, Molecular Biology and Physiology. According to data from OpenAlex, Masayoshi Uchida has authored 16 papers receiving a total of 337 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Neurology, 4 papers in Molecular Biology and 4 papers in Physiology. Recurrent topics in Masayoshi Uchida's work include Traumatic Brain Injury and Neurovascular Disturbances (4 papers), Nitric Oxide and Endothelin Effects (3 papers) and Aortic Disease and Treatment Approaches (2 papers). Masayoshi Uchida is often cited by papers focused on Traumatic Brain Injury and Neurovascular Disturbances (4 papers), Nitric Oxide and Endothelin Effects (3 papers) and Aortic Disease and Treatment Approaches (2 papers). Masayoshi Uchida collaborates with scholars based in Japan, United States and Slovakia. Masayoshi Uchida's co-authors include Patricia D. Hurn, Jian Cheng, Paco S. Herson, A. Courtney DeVries, Mami Iida, Kozaburo Akiyoshi, Shuji Dohi, Elton Migliati, Anne D. Lewis and Bing Zhang and has published in prestigious journals such as The Journal of Immunology, Journal of Cerebral Blood Flow & Metabolism and Anesthesia & Analgesia.
